Probably the most circulated footage in German sports activities media prior to now yr reveals Jude Bellingham sitting alongside Jamal Musiala, each 17 on the time and sporting England jerseys. The image spotlights the friendship between two gifted gamers who as soon as performed towards one another at ping-pong tables and online game consoles, and have now grow to be dominant within the German Bundesliga. Whereas Bellingham already had his first statement performance for England on Monday, his good pal is set to do the identical on Wednesday when Germany meet Japan in World Cup Group E.
“I feel now we have a extremely good group with which we are able to get actually far,” Musiala tells ESPN. “The standard is there to be a contender for the title. We go to this event with the mindset to have the ability to win the cup. You must consider in it. I do.”
The 19-year-old has travelled to Qatar with enormous ambitions and the result of Germany’s World Cup title quest is dependent upon Musiala greater than some folks could understand. Through the first half of the season, he was the standout participant at Bayern Munich, the place head coach Julian Nagelsmann has begun to construct your entire system round Musiala as his No. 10.
Germany head coach Hansi Flick, who mentored the up-and-coming expertise throughout his time at Bayern Munich and wished him to decide on Germany over England (the place Musiala had performed for Chelsea‘s academy from 2011 to 2019) has additionally recognized his former pupil because the centerpiece of his offensive construction, with Musiala offering a component of unpredictability due to his dribbling abilities.
“Musiala is a primary instance of what we wish to name a ‘needle participant’ — a participant who carries the ball via small gaps and tight areas in-between a number of opponents. His method, however particularly his agility and fast decision-making, permit him to do this like not many others,” says tactical analyst and coach Martin Rafelt.
Musiala could very nicely be probably the most gifted pocket footballer on the planet alongside Barcelona and Spain midfielder Pedri. The conflict between the 2 heavyweights on Sunday could possibly be epic. However whereas Pedri is broadly admired in Spain, Musiala continues to be underrated in some fan circles at dwelling. One reporter not too long ago famous that Germany’s soccer has been predominantly about counter-pressing and depth prior to now decade and {that a} skinny teenager with mild ft contradicts a perception system.
“A enjoying fashion like Musiala’s is commonly considered too dangerous, however it’s immensely precious to interrupt down compact defenses, particularly to do this shortly and ceaselessly with out the necessity of being extraordinarily affected person,” Rafelt explains. For many years, Germany’s fashion of soccer has revolved round passing. The World Cup-winning groups of 1974, 1990 and 2014 all relied closely on exact and clever passes, whereas dribbles have been a lot much less outstanding. Musiala embodies a extra provocative fashion in that he purposely strikes into closely coated areas and takes on one and even two opponents.

“I feel I play extra offensively than final season the place I used to be typically used as a No. 6 and needed to be taught that first,” Musiala says. “Now, I’ve discovered a place during which I really feel actually snug. I additionally like my rhythm and take it from recreation to recreation.”
What helps Musiala other than his pure footballing abilities is how he offers with psychological stress. The shut relationship along with his mom, who raised him and his youthful sister on her personal, and the truth that he reveals barely any curiosity in luxuries helps him give attention to his recreation.
“In my time as a reporter, I’ve met few gamers who’re so down-to-earth, which for my part isn’t solely because of the truth that he has not been a part of this millionaires’ recreation for lengthy but in addition due to his character and mindset,” says Munich-based journalist Kerry Hau who has been following Musiala since he arrived at Bayern in 2019. Hau additionally attributes Musiala’s humbleness partially to his upbringing in England the place academies is usually a bit tough for younger prospects. “He’s a man who had nothing gifted to him and needed to work arduous for every thing.”
Being decided and pushed in his occupation lets him perceive the sport faster and strategy it with extra maturity than most 19-year-olds even on the highest stage. “I all the time attempt to work on myself,” Musiala explains. “For instance, my scoring in entrance of the objective was already good. However, I labored arduous on it to be as environment friendly as attainable, principally with [Bayern’s] assistant coach Dino Toppmoller after coaching. Now, I am much more typically in positions from which I can shoot. We prepare precisely the conditions that I additionally get through the recreation. The sort of objectives I rating now, I’ve already executed in coaching.”
Musiala’s capability to not solely create goal-scoring alternatives for others via his dribbles but in addition his urgency to attain himself could also be essential for Germany through the World Cup, because the four-time champions wouldn’t have a top-class striker of their squad.
“He has outgrown the prospect standing because the summer season, which you’ll be able to inform from how he interacts with reporters,” Hau says. “He’s rather more relaxed and never so shy anymore. He’s a person now who doesn’t have any points to maintain up bodily and with the calls for of enjoying within the beginning line-up each three days.”
Maybe some discover it worrying that Flick has to depend on a 19-year-old who’s at present in his second full season on the senior stage, however Musiala is undoubtedly a generational expertise with unparalleled qualities. “He shares a enjoying fashion with Mario Gotze and to a lesser extent with Kai Havertz, Leroy Sane and Julian Brandt, however he is ready to do it with extra drive in the direction of the objective than Gotze and wishes even much less house than the opposite three,” Rafelt says.
Mario Gotze was Germany’s golden boy a decade in the past who fell from grace within the years after his World Cup-winning objective in 2014. Due to a resurgence within the Bundesliga following a transfer to Eintracht Frankfurt this summer season, Flick has given Gotze a brand new probability by choosing him for the World Cup squad. The on-the-pitch similarities between Gotze and Musiala are a bonus for each in that Gotze can function a backup for the beginning playmaker, whereas Musiala might be able to profit from Gotze’s expertise.
A mentor-like determine for Musiala is Manchester City‘s Ilkay Gundogan, who has been quoted telling Musiala throughout video games that he would shield the areas behind him as a result of Gundogan needs his younger team-mate to thrive. The veterans who have been a part of the 2018 World Cup marketing campaign which resulted in a bunch stage exit know that Musiala brings one thing to the desk nobody else can.
His unpredictability is precisely what Germany may have, significantly in video games during which lengthy spells of possession go nowhere. It absolutely is a heavy activity for a 19-year-old to grow to be a possible difference-maker for a nation like Germany, however Musiala has the instruments to deal with it.
